§ 255-111.   Outdoor storage and waste disposal.
   A.   No flammable or explosive liquids, solids or gases shall be stored in bulk above the ground; provided, however, that tanks or drums directly connecting with energy devices, heating devices or appliances located on the same as the tanks or drums are excluded from this provision.
   B.   All outdoor storage facilities for fuel, raw materials and products stored outdoors, including those permitted in Subsection A hereinabove, shall be enclosed by a fence of a type, and size as in the opinion of the Board of Township Commissioners shall be adequate to protect and conceal the facilities from any adjacent properties. In determining the same, the Commissioners shall not only consider the question of safety, but the screening as determined by the Board of Commissioners may be in the nature of trees, shrubbery, etc.
   C.   No materials or wastes which might cause fumes or dust or which constitute a fire hazard or which may be edible or otherwise be attractive to rodents or insects shall be stored except outdoors only in closed containers. [Amended 1-10-1995 by Ord. No. 879]
   D.   Flammable or explosive liquids, solids or gases may not be placed or stored within 200 feet of a residential zoning district. [Added 7-14-1998 by Ord. No. 972]
